6 Tips for Effectively Managing a Small Business with AI

AI, artificial intelligence

By Kamy Anderson, guest contributor.

Artificial intelligence is everywhere.

A recent global consumer survey has shown that while 33% of consumers think they use AI tech, the actual number is much higher. Currently, around 77% of people use popular AI-enabled devices and services whether they’re aware of that or not.

The same goes for businesses.

Modern-day entrepreneurs falsely believe that AI-driven business technology cannot be afforded at the small to medium-sized business (SMB) level. They associate machine intelligence with mega-brands such as Apple or Google, failing to realize that AI has already been commercialized.

In reality, AI boasts numerous benefits for businesses, both large and small. Regardless of how small and no matter which industry, your business can leverage its immense potential, too. The only thing you need is an AI tool that’s suitable for your needs.

Here’s how to make the most of AI biz tech:

1. Big Data Analysis & Decision Making

AI is a brilliant research tool.

Not only are there various AI-driven tools that can help you sift thought business-related online data in a matter of minutes, but there are also AI solutions that excel at collecting data from your leads, customers, and even competitors. You only need to know where to look.

At an SMB level, the so-called big data analysis implies deep research of market fluctuations, economic trends, and customer behaviour. These tools provide you with actionable insight that you can use for both on-the-spot problem-solving and long-term decision-making.

Needless to say, (pre)knowledge is often the most reliable growth hack.

2. Better, Smarter, and Faster Marketing

The most obvious use of modern-day AI tools is in marketing, where every aspect of artificial intelligence can help contribute to your overall goal – delighting, attracting, and eventually converting new customers. AI automation plays a crucial role in modern lead generation.

Consider email marketing, for instance.

Without AI to automate triggered emails and match the right type of response to the right audience segment at the most opportune moment of their customer journey, SMBs would hardly be able to compete with their heavily automated large-scale competitors and their tools.

Similar AI solutions are available for social media marketing as well and, lately, content curation. SMBs usually cannot meet the modern content demand on their own, but AI can help them with research, curation, and writing. Though still in the development phase, these tools will be the next big thing.

3. Targeted Sales & AI-Based Conversion

You may already be employing some of the most effective lead generation strategies out there, leveraging the power of LinkedIn, for example. But, presuming your lead generation tactics don’t lead to instant on-site conversions, your organization needs an effective sales optimization solution as well. Luckily for you, there are different types of solutions available. Look for the best sales automation tool based on your sales strategy.

If you’re hoping to boost your website traffic and increase your on-site conversions, then deploying a chatbot may be the best idea. These AI-based digital assistants are very cheap, available 24/7, and capable of providing real-time guidance.

Using machine learning (ML) and natural language processing (NLP), chatbots carry out smart and engaging conversations with website visitors, thus reducing your organization’s bounce rate and pushing leads further down the sales funnel.

4. Building Profitable Customer Relations

Chatbots are also highly effective when it comes to customer retention.

Having said that, there are other far better ways for SMBs to build long-lasting customer relationships using AI. The so-called sentiment analysis, for instance. This AI-powered solution allows you to understand exactly how your customers are feeling while they are interacting with your brand.

Sentiment analysis relies on AI to scan, analyze, and classify different human emotions by taking textual cues from emails and other text messages. It may sound futuristic, but sentiment analysis tools are already being used by huge corporations and many SMBs all around the world.

5. Finding the Right Hire for a Company Culture

While not applicable to sole proprietorships, AI’s capabilities as a potent research and analysis tool are being leveraged by HR specialists in mid-to-large-sized operations to help automate and improve the recruitment process. Not only is AI able to search the global databases in pursuit of talent, but it’s also able to recognize the right cultural fit when it sees it.

AI-based automation contributes to modern-day recruiting in numerous ways. By putting the screening process on auto-pilot, AI eliminates the unconscious bias and allows recruiters to stay focused on more essential parts of the process, such as conducting interviews.

But the best thing about AI-driven recruitment is that it allows SMBs to hire for attitude and train for skills. This is another aspect of business where sentiment analysis can be of immense help and separate great hires from average ones.

6. Employee Satisfaction & Personalized Learning and Development (L&D)

Happy employees are productive employees.

No business, big or small, can hope to stay relevant and competitive without happy and productive employees. Fortunately, AI can help you create a stimulating and fulfilling work environment. Intelligent tech can serve as both facilitator and a method of continual improvement.

As a facilitator, AI allows employees to establish a healthy work-life balance and stay motivated by their jobs. With automation tools and digital assistants being able to complete routine tasks, your employees can focus on creative problem-solving, which is key to business innovation.

But AI is also a crucial part of today’semployee training software.

Using sentiment analysis and other assessment solutions, career development specialists can create a course and provide personalized training programs for clients and career paths for employees, if applicable. This keeps employees motivated to learn and improve, which in return contributes to your bottom line.
